Aberrant Splicing of MBD1 Reshapes the Epigenome to Drive Convergent Myeloerythroid Defects in MDS

Abstract

Splicing defects are a characteristic feature of myelodysplastic syndromes (MDS) and typically associate with specific recurrent splicing factor mutations. However, a subset of transcripts exhibit abnormal splicing regardless of mutational background, occurring even in the absence of splicing-related mutations.
